Intelligent Space helps develop and evaluate crowd management strategies for major events. Pedestrian modelling identifies the likely effect of physical event design on patterns of access, egress and crowd density prior to the event. Using observation studies and risk assessment, we provide design guidance to help minimise risks for crowd safety.
